How hike in the price of stamp duties can impact the Real Estate Sector?


Among all the cities in India, Mumbai is one of the most crowded places. The huge population needs more residence to settle down. However, Mumbai offers only a limited area for its residents. This makes accommodating all the people in this limited area almost impossible. Hence, Mumbaikars have to incur more expenses to buy a property.
Living in Mumbai is a dream of thousands of people, but this dream will soon become much more expensive as there are no signs of the real estate price dropping anytime soon. Also, there will be an increase in the price of stamp duties, which is to be paid while purchasing the house. Whether you would like to buy an apartment at DB Skypark or rent a place, the stamp duty price has to be paid.
In the recent events, it has been witnessed that the stamp duties have already hiked by one percent. Last year, the amendment bill for raising the stamp duty was extended by the Mumbai Municipal Corporation which got approved by the Maharashtra Legislative Assembly. This hike in the stamp duty prices will have a huge impact on the real estate sector. Buyers will bear the cost of the stamp duty fees, and the price of the house will therefore increase as well.
Since the stamp duty fees has been increased as per the amendment bill by Mumbai Municipal Corporation, the Mumbai real estate sector will witness a huge rise in the price of the property, 6% to 7% more than earlier. The hike in the price of stamp duties was imposed to tackle the ever-increasing population problem in Mumbai. Mumbai roads always stay congested with traffic, which makes reaching ones destination on time very difficult. To minimise this issue, the Maharashtra government is introducing new projects such as Monorail, Eastern Freeway, Metro service, and Bandra-Worli Sealink to increase the convenience of the citizens. The money collected due to the hike in the price of stamp duty will be used to benefit the development of these projects.
